About the artist
Adam J. Kurtz (aka Adam JK) is a designer, artist, and speaker whose illustrative work is rooted in honesty, humor and a little darkness. His books have been translated into over a dozen languages.
Kurtz speaks frankly about channeling human emotion into our art, and generally just trying to be more okay with whatever we've got.
